Description[?]:
The Telamon Labor Party is the only national political party, with branches in every State and Territory. The TLP is made up of a diverse group of people with common goals who work together to represent a range of interests and outlooks. Telamon Labor's enduring policy objectives include: 1) A fairer distribution of political and economic power. 2) Restoration of full employment. 3) Greater equality in the distribution of income, wealth and opportunity. 4) Equal access and rights to employment, education, health and other community services and activities. 5) More democratic control, ownership and participation in Telamon industry. 6) Maintenance of world peace; and an independent Telamon position in world affairs. |

Random fact: Particracy allows you to establish an unelected head of state like a monarch or a president-for-life, but doing this is a bit of a process. First elect a candidate with the name "." to the Head of State position. Then change your law on the "Structure of the executive branch" to "The head of state is hereditary and symbolic; the head of government chairs the cabinet" and change the "formal title of the head of state" to how you want the new head of state's title and name to appear (eg. King Percy XVI). |
